到本世纪八十年代止世界上出现过的直接还原铁(Direction Reduction Iron-DRI)法已有100多种,但其中大部由于经济原因已被淘汰,至今仍在生产和继续发展的还有数十种。它们基本可以分成两类,即以天然气裂化产物(H_2+CO)的H_2为主要还原剂的天然气裂化还原法,和以固体燃料煤炭产生(H_2+CO)中的CO为还原剂的煤基还原法。1984年DRI的产量达925万吨,设计能力在2020万吨以上,其中天然气裂化法占95%以上,主要集中在天然气丰富兼有铁矿石的地
